编程是当今数字化时代的核心技能之一,无论是开发软件、设计网站还是解决问题,编程都扮演着至关重要的角色。无论您是初学者还是有经验的开发者,掌握编程技能都能为您带来巨大的价值和机会。本文将引导您从编程的基础知识入门,逐步探索编程世界,直至精通各种编程语言和技术。
编程语言是编写计算机程序的基础,选择合适的编程语言取决于您的目标和应用场景。例如,如果您想开发网站,可以选择HTML、CSS和JavaScript;如果您对数据分析感兴趣,Python是一个很好的选择;而如果您想开发移动应用,可以学习Java或Swift等。
在开始学习具体的编程语言之前,了解一些基本的编程概念是非常重要的。这些概念包括变量、数据类型、条件语句、循环和函数等。掌握这些概念可以帮助您更好地理解和编写代码。
学会使用编程工具是成为一名优秀程序员的必备技能。一些常用的编程工具包括文本编辑器(如Visual Studio Code、Sublime Text等)、集成开发环境(如PyCharm、Eclipse等)和版本控制工具(如Git)等。
数据结构和算法是编程的基础,是优化代码和解决问题的关键。学习常见的数据结构(如数组、链表、栈、队列、树、图等)以及常用的算法(如排序、搜索、递归、动态规划等)可以提高您的编程技能。
面向对象编程是一种常见的编程范式,它将数据和操作封装在对象中,提高了代码的可重用性和可维护性。学习面向对象编程的概念和原则,并掌握常见的面向对象编程语言(如Java、C 、Python等)是非常重要的。
软件工程是一门研究如何以系统化、规范化、可量化的方法开发和维护软件的学科。学习软件工程原理可以帮助您更好地组织和管理项目,提高团队协作效率,减少开发成本和风险。
随着技术的不断发展,新的编程语言和框架不断涌现。不断学习和掌握新的编程语言和框架可以帮助您跟上技术的潮流,拓展自己的技能树,增加就业机会。
参与开源项目和社区是提升编程技能的有效途径之一。通过与其他开发者合作、分享经验和解决问题,可以加速您的学习过程,积累项目经验,提升自己的可见度和影响力。
编程是一门需要不断练习和实践的技能。通过解决实际问题、开发个人项目或参与竞赛,可以巩固所学知识,发现和解决问题,提升自己的编程能力和信心。
编程是一项充满挑战和机遇的技能,它不仅可以帮助您解决问题、实现梦想,还可以为您的职业生涯带来更多的选择和机会。通过不断学习、实践和提升,相信您一定能够在编程的世界里大展拳脚,成为一名优秀的程序员!
无论您是初学者还是有经验的开发者,都要相信自己的能力,勇敢迈出第一步,踏上学习编程的旅程吧!
版权声明:本文为 “联成科技技术有限公司” 原创文章,转载请附上原文出处链接及本声明;